H.R. 5392 (109th)

To amend the Robert T. Stafford Disaster Relief and Emergency Assistance Act to direct the President to extend the availability of unemployment assistance made available in connection with Hurricane Katrina and Hurricane Rita.

Summary

Directs the President to make unemployment assistance available to eligible individuals under the Robert T. Stafford Disaster Relief and Emergency Assistance Act as a result of a disaster declaration for Hurricane Katrina or Rita for 52 weeks after the date of such declaration.
